Tender Description
DESCRIPTION OF WORK
Delta aims to engage a qualified and experienced consultancy to identify and evaluate potential sites for the development of a gas turbine facility with a capacity of up to 667MW. The site will be developed into either an Open-Cycle Gas Turbine (OCGT) or Combined-Cycle Gas Turbine (CCGT) facility.
ABOUT US
The Vales Point Power Station is located on the southern shore of Lake Macquarie, approximately 130 km north of Sydney, New South Wales, and approximately 3 km off the Pacific Highway North of Doyalson.
The Delta Group is part of the Sev.en Global Investments Pty Ltd (Sev.en GI) Group, a family office investment company based in the Czech Republic. Sev.en GI has a global presence with investments in power generation, mining, and mineral mining rights portfolios across key focus regions in North America, Australia, Europe, and Asia.

EXTENT OF WORK
As part of this engagement, the consultancy will deliver a comprehensive report structured as follows:
- Site Identification
- Infrastructure Assessment
- Site Evaluation
- Risk Assessment
The consultancy is expected to deliver the following:
1. Preliminary Report (Deliverable 1)
- Initial list of potential sites with basic evaluation criteria
2. Final / Detailed Feasibility Report (Deliverable 2)
- Comprehensive evaluation and ranking of shortlisted sites
- Infrastructure assessments and risk analysis
- Consolidated findings, recommendations, and an executive summary
